问题 选择题

Even if the treatment ________, there is still no magic pill for patients in the late stages of AIDs.

A.does

B.uses

C.works

D.helps

答案

答案:C

题目分析:考查动词辨析:A. does 做,B. uses使用C. works 起作用D. helps帮助

works起作用的意思,即治疗有效,如it works,就是它起作用了,选C。

点评:动词的词义辨析主要放在上下文的语境中进行,要注意动词的固定搭配和上下文串联。还要注意有的动词一词多义,要多记忆一些含义。

     April Fools' Day is supposed to be a day to play jokes on others in hopes of getting a good laugh and

making one feel like a fool. However, the April Fools' Day of 2010 was quite different for my mom and me.

     That day my friend Jimmy and I were playing a game. I had dropped down from a bar (横木) many

times in the past without ever having a problem, but that day the simple act of dropping to the ground became

a nightmare (噩梦). I broke my arm.

     Jimmy's dad heard my crying and rushed out to see what was going on. When he saw the problem, he

quickly put me into his truck and went inside to telephone my mom and let her know he would take me to

the hospital. As that day was April Fools' Day, Mom was not buying it and really thought all this was a big

joke. Mom was finally convinced by Jimmy's mom. When she saw me, she broke down in tears because

she felt so bad-she originally (开始) thought this was just a big prank (恶作剧).

     I guess one could compare this to the story of "The Boy Who Cried Wolf". Since I had pulled pranks

before, it is no wonder that my mom didn't believe it. I as well as my mom was made to look like a fool

that day. We both learned a valuable lesson.
